Staff Platform Engineer (Python)

Remote: 
Full Remote
Contract: 
Work from: 

Offer summary

Qualifications:

8+ years of experience in back-end software engineering developing enterprise applications., 5+ years designing and implementing cloud-based architectures using AWS, GCP, or Azure., Advanced proficiency in Python and strong proficiency in SQL databases., Experience with microservices architecture and containerization tools like Docker and Kubernetes..

Key responsabilities:

  • Design, develop, and maintain complex software across multiple technology domains.
  • Lead architecture/design sessions and mentor junior engineers.
  • Ensure stability and scalability of the PatientPoint platform and improve code quality.
  • Perform detailed reviews on deliverables and provide technical guidance to team members.

PatientPoint® logo
PatientPoint® SME https://www.patientpoint.com/
501 - 1000 Employees
See all jobs

Job description

Join PatientPoint to be part of a dynamic team committed to empower better health. As a leading digital health company, we innovate to positively impact patient behaviors. Our purpose-driven approach offers an inspirational career opportunity where you can contribute to improving health outcomes for millions of patients nationwide.

Location: Remote (Must Reside in Eastern or Central Time Zones)
Travel Requirements: 4-5 weeks per year 

Job Summary  

The Staff Platform Engineer has expertise in the implementation and design of software platforms, including infrastructure, methodology, process, and tool stack. In this role, you’ll work to create bring a new product line to the next level using Python and AWS cloud. You thrive in environments where you are focused on writing performant code that supports enterprise-grade architecture. You enjoy the experience of writing software for scale and take ownership of the products that you contribute. You’re seeking to drive tangible impact in your next career opportunity. You want to build things that matter. 

What You’ll Do  

  • Designs, develops, and maintains larger, more complex software spanning multiple technology domains. 
  • Identifies cross-cutting concerns within and across service boundaries and implements reusable modules 
  • Hands on development of enterprise applications 80% of the time 
  • Responsible for stability and scalability of the PatientPoint platform. This encompasses business services and platform agnostic (mobile & web) application endpoints. 
  • Develop solutions following established technical design, application development standards and quality processes in projects. 
  • Facilitate and lead story breakup and grooming. Drive feature level architecture/design sessions. 
  • Increase the level of teams’ technical ability and drive measurable improvement of quality of code. 
  • Improve accuracy of development schedules and lowers project risk. 
  • Perform detailed reviews on deliverables. Provide technical guidance to the team members. 
  • Mentor Junior Individual Contributors, provide oversight of others’ work. 

What We Need  

  • 8+ years experience in a back-end software engineering role developing enterprise applications.  
  • 5+ years of experience designing and implementing cloud-based architectures using AWS, GCP, or Azure
  • 2+ years experience developing microservices architecture  
  • Advanced proficiency in Python (a coding assessment will be administered)
  • Strong proficiency in working with SQL databases

Desired Qualifications  

  • Experience with Ad Technology platforms and tools
  • Experience in Medical or EHR (Electronic Health Record) technologies
  • Hands-on experience designing or utilizing Service-Oriented Architectures (SOA)
  • Proficient with containerization and orchestration tools such as Docker, ECS, and Kubernetes
  • Knowledge of cloud-based security principles, including data encryption, hashing, and secret management
  • Experience with reactive programming and building multi-threaded, high-performance systems
  • Proven ability to collaborate with cross-functional teams, including Product, DevOps, and Security
  • Experience developing applications using Django
  • Familiarity with JavaScript and ReactJS for front-end development
  • Experience mentoring and guiding junior engineers

What You'll Need to Succeed  

  • Self-motivation, strong ambition, and interest in directly impacting business results.  
  • Resourcefulness, multi-tasking skills and creative problem-solving skills. 
  • Curiosity and a strong passion for data, trend analysis and storytelling through data. 
  • Resiliency and ability to overcome challenges, sound business judgment.  
  • Passion for relationship building and building trusted partnerships.  

Base Salary Band: $140,296.00 - $219,608.00

Compensation: At PatientPoint, we are committed to providing competitive pay and benefits that are in line with industry standards. We analyze and carefully consider several factors when determining compensation, including skills, qualifications, geographic location, and professional experience, which can cause your compensation to vary. The base salary range listed is just one component of PatientPoint’s total compensation package for employees. For additional details on our total benefits package, please review the section “About PatientPoint” at the end of this job description.

#LI-ED1 #LI-Remote 


About PatientPoint: 
PatientPoint is a leading digital health company that connects patients, healthcare providers and life sciences companies with the right information in the moments care decisions are made. Our solutions are proven to influence patient behavior and improve health outcomes, driving value for all stakeholders. Across the nation’s largest network of connected digital devices in 35,000 physician offices, PatientPoint solutions empower better health for more than 750 million patient visits each year.

Latest News & Innovations: 

  1. Named A Best Place to Work Across Multiple Prestigious Platforms! Read More
  2. Featured on Built In's article "Companies That Pay Well". Read More
  3. Now Culture Content Certified by VentureFizz. Read More

What We Offer: 
We know you bring your whole self to work every day, and we are committed to supporting our full-time teammates with a comprehensive range of modernized benefits and cultural perks. We offer competitive compensation, flexible time off to recharge, hybrid work options, mental and emotional wellness resources, a 401K plan, and more. While these benefits are available to full-time team members, we strive to create a positive and supportive environment for all teammates.

PatientPoint recognizes that privacy is important to you. Please read the PatientPoint privacy policy, we want you to be familiar with how we may collect, use, and disclose your information. Employer is EOE/M/F/D/V

Required profile

Experience

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Mentorship
  • Resilience
  • Multitasking
  • Resourcefulness
  • Creative Problem Solving
  • Curiosity
  • Relationship Building
  • Self-Motivation

Platform Engineer Related jobs